Oscar Wilde was one of Victorian Britain’s most famous writers. He is best known for the play The Importance of Being Earnest, the novel The Picture of Dorian Gray, and the poem The Ballad of Reading Gaol, which he wrote in prison while reflecting on justice and human suffering. The modern label “gay” did not exist during Oscar Wilde’s lifetime in the late 1800s.
